Company Introduction

Agri-Siam is a Thai rice licensed trader who specializes in all types and grades of Thai rice. We have very strong corporation with several major rice mills in Northeastern and Central Thailand, which means we are direct to all of our suppliers. We can and are ready to supply Thai rice in bulk quantities.

We Offer Premium quality:

1. Thai Hom Mali (Jasmine) Rice

2. Thai Pathumthani Rice

3. Thai White Rice

4. Thai Broken Rice

5. Thai Parboiled Rice

6. Thai Glutinous Rice

7. Vietnamese White Rice
